Are You A Veteran or Concerned About One?

There is help available for Veterans and their families who are dealing with any type of crisis.  The Veteran’s Crisis Line can help you find treatment, access resources in your community, and talk to others who are facing the same challenges. 

There are over 600,000 veterans in Arizona – you are not alone.
